During apoptosis, phosphatidylserine is translocated from the inner to the outer plasma membrane leaflet.

This externalization was analyzed with annexin V FITC staining to examine apoptotic states of the different cell populations after Inhibitors,Modulators,Libraries treatment with 210 nM C16 and Ab42 exposure for 72 h. Furthermore, the apoptosis detection kit includes propidium iodide to label the cellular DNA in necrotic cells. This combination allows the differentiation among early apoptotic cells, necrotic cells, and viable cells. In all conditions examined, no PI staining associated with annexin V FITC staining was observed.
